Displacement Controlled Photon Number Resolving Detector for Coherent State Discrimination

Abstract

The presented probabilistic scheme for discrimination of optical coherent states consists of an optimized displacement followed by postselection of a photon number resolving measurement. The scheme outperforms the homodyne receiver in theory and experiment.
